Description
Spaghetti with Pepper Cream, Chorizo & Shrimp is a savory and creamy pasta dish featuring succulent shrimp, spicy chorizo, and a flavorful pepper cream sauce.
Ingredients
Scale
- 250g spaghetti
- 1 red pepper, diced
- 150g chorizo, cut into cubes
- 200g peeled shrimp
- 1 onion, chopped
- 2 garlic cloves, crushed
- 20cl thick sour cream
- Olive oil
- Salt, pepper
Instructions
- Cook the spaghetti according to the instructions on the package. Drain and set aside.
- In a large skillet, sauté the chopped onion and crushed garlic in olive oil over medium heat until softened.
- Add the diced red pepper and chorizo cubes. Cook for about 5 minutes, allowing the chorizo to release its flavor.
- Add the peeled shrimp and cook for another 2 minutes until they turn pink and opaque.
- Lower the heat and stir in the sour cream.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Combine the drained spaghetti with the sauce mixture and toss until evenly coated.
- Serve hot, optionally garnished with fresh herbs or grated cheese.
Notes
- For added spice, consider using a spicier chorizo or adding chili flakes to the sauce.
- Feel free to use a low-fat sour cream or substitute with heavy cream for a richer flavor.
- If you prefer, you can add other vegetables like spinach or mushrooms for extra flavor and texture.
